Sewer Pipe Clearing in Denver, CO
Sewer pipe clearing services focus on removing blockages and obstructions from residential sewer lines to restore proper flow and prevent backups. This service is commonly requested for issues such as slow drains, foul odors, or recurring clogs in kitchen sinks, toilets, or main sewer lines. Projects can range from clearing minor clogs in individual fixtures to addressing more extensive blockages in the main sewer line that affect the entire property. Property owners should be aware that the process often involves specialized equipment like augers or hydro jetting tools to effectively remove debris, grease, or tree roots that may be causing the obstruction.
Before requesting sewer pipe clearing,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the problem, including whether the issue is localized or affects the entire sewer system. It’s helpful to know if there are any warning signs such as multiple fixtures draining slowly or gurgling sounds. Additionally, understanding the potential causes of blockages and the methods used to clear them can aid in planning and preventing future issues. Proper diagnosis and clearing can help maintain a healthy plumbing system and avoid costly repairs down the line.

Sewer Pipe Clearing Questions
What causes sewer pipe clogs? Common causes include tree roots, accumulated debris, grease buildup, and damaged pipes.
How can I tell if my sewer pipe is blocked? Signs include slow drains, gurgling sounds, foul odors, or sewage backups in fixtures.
Are chemical drain cleaners effective for clearing sewer pipes? Chemical cleaners may provide temporary relief but often do not solve underlying issues and can damage pipes.
What types of sewer pipe clearing methods are available? Methods include snaking, hydro jetting, and camera inspection to identify and remove blockages effectively.
